Abstract
A wireless terminal may present a graphical representation of telephone keys serially along at least one edge of the display screen. A user may indicate selection of one of the telephone keys. The wireless terminal may detect the selection of the one of the telephone keys and generate a signal corresponding to the one of the telephone keys selected.

10. A wireless handheld terminal comprising:
-
a processor; a memory; a display screen defined by at least one edge; computer instructions stored in the memory and executable by the processor (i) to cause presentation on the display screen of a graphical representation of telephone keys serially along the at least one edge of the display screen, wherein each telephone key is located on the display screen along one of the edges of the display screen, and wherein the graphical representation is selectable by a user, (ii) to detect that a portion of the graphical representation has been selected, the portion corresponding to a given one of the telephone keys, and (iii) to output a signal that defines the given one of the telephone keys. - View Dependent Claims (11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18)

19. A display screen of a wireless terminal comprising:
-
an edge portion of the display screen for displaying a graphical representation of telephone keys on the display screen, wherein each telephone key is located on the display screen serially along one of the edges of the display screen, and wherein the graphical representation is selectable by a user; and a display portion of the display screen for displaying content associated with an application running on the wireless terminal prior to the graphical representation of telephone keys being displayed; and wherein the display screen includes a means for detecting that a portion of the graphical representation has been selected, the portion corresponding to a given one of the telephone keys.
